6 Stocks to Sell Before the End of the Year

from The Morning Filter · host Morningstar

On this week’s episode of The Morning Filter podcast, Dave Sekera and Susan Dziubinski discuss why a Fed rate cut in December is starting to look unlikely. They also unpack new research about Palo Alto Networks PANW and Walmart WMT after earnings. And they cover whether Nvidia NVDA is a buy after another stunning quarter.They take a deeper-than-usual dive into the audience mailbag, answering questions about AI and data center stocks, lithium and Albemarle ALB, and uncertainty and when to take profits.
